Phone number ☎️ 02034091406 👆 is reported as a persistent scam number used mainly by callers falsely claiming to be from Microsoft or other tech support representatives. Victims often hear warnings about computer viruses or security issues, with attempts to extract payment or gain remote access to devices. The callers typically have Asian accents and hang up when challenged or questioned. Many users note repeated calls, silent answers, or hang-ups immediately after picking up. The number has been flagged frequently for fraudulent activity and nuisance calls, leading to widespread blocking across the UK. Users are strongly advised not to engage or provide any personal information, and to block the number promptly to avoid potential scams or identity theft.

These scammers from Eastern Europe tried the usual spiel about my computer being hacked and offering to fix it, went on for about 15 minutes. I played along and kept asking technical questions about their ‘protection’ methods. Eventually, the guy asked if I actually knew anything about computers. When I said I run an IT business (the one he’d just called), he got pretty angry, cursed at me, and ended the call. Honestly, it was well worth wasting their time instead of letting them fool and frighten others.

Some bloke rang me saying he was from Windows and that there was an issue with my laptop. He told me to press ctrl, fn and r all at once. I just played along like I was doing it. Then he asked what was showing on my screen, I told him it was just loads of random letters. After that, he just hung up on me.

About 02 Numbers

These digits are linked with specific locations in the UK and are typically used by homes and businesses. Often called as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the costs for these geographic numbers are dependent on the time of day. Several service providers offer call packages that offer free calls during designated times. Call costs from mobile phones are according to the chosen calling plan, with a number of plans containing these numbers in their free call packages.
